Comprehending Window Seals and Their Function
A window seal refers to the barrier in between the exterior and interior elements of a window unit. In modern double-pane and triple-pane windows, seals are developed to create an airtight space between the glass panes, which is typically filled with insulating gas such as argon or krypton. This seal avoids moisture from going into deep space in between panes while concurrently avoiding the insulating gas from getting away.
The primary seal, often called the primary seal or glazing seal, is usually made from silicone or polyurethane substances. This seal bonds straight to the glass and the spacer bar that separates the panes. Surrounding this main barrier is a secondary seal, typically crafted from polyisobutylene, which offers additional protection versus air and moisture infiltration. Together, these seals produce a thermal barrier that considerably decreases heat transfer through the windows.
When window seals work appropriately, they remain invisible to the house owner, working quietly to maintain comfy indoor temperature levels and clear views through the glass. Nevertheless, when these seals degrade or stop working, the repercussions can impact both the performance of the windows and the overall comfort of the home environment.
Signs of Window Seal Failure
Acknowledging the early indicators of window seal failure enables homeowners to address issues before they intensify into more considerable issues. The most common and visible sign of seal failure is condensation or fogging in between the glass panes. Unlike condensation on the interior surface area of windows, which generally takes place due to high indoor humidity levels, wetness caught between panes suggests that the seal has been jeopardized and outdoor air has actually infiltrated the seal cavity.
Beyond condensation, house owners might notice a sudden boost in their heating and cooling costs. Failed seals allow conditioned air to get away and outdoor air to get in, requiring HVAC systems to work more difficult to maintain comfy temperature levels. This inefficiency typically manifests as unexplained spikes in energy bills, particularly during extreme weather seasons.
Another indicator includes the appearance of mineral deposits or staining on the interior surfaces of the glass. As moisture infiltrates the seal cavity and consequently evaporates, it leaves minerals from the spacer bar and desiccant products, developing noticeable streaks or staining that can not be cleaned from the inside. In more advanced cases, property owners may notice that the glass panes have actually shifted slightly or that the spacer bar has ended up being noticeable at the edges of the window unit.
Common Causes of Window Seal Deterioration
Window seals break down gradually due to a combination of ecological elements and use. Comprehending these causes assists house owners carry out preventive measures and comprehend why their seals might have stopped working.
Temperature fluctuations represent among the primary causes of seal degeneration. As windows expand and agreement with modifications in temperature level, the seal products experience continuous tension. Over years of thermal biking, this repetitive tension causes the seal products to lose their flexibility and eventually crack or separate from the glass surfaces. Houses located in areas with severe seasonal temperature variations experience this kind of wear more rapidly than those in more temperate environments.
Ultraviolet radiation from sunshine also contributes considerably to seal deterioration. The UV rays that brighten a space likewise break down the chemical bonds in seal materials, causing them to end up being fragile and less reliable at maintaining their bond. Windows that get direct sunshine throughout the day tend to experience faster seal wear and tear than those in shaded locations of the home.
Physical damage throughout window cleansing or maintenance can also jeopardize seals. Utilizing sharp tools or abrasive products near seal edges, applying excessive pressure when cleansing, or mistakenly striking the window frame can all damage the seal integrity. Evaluation and Repair Options
When window seal problems are identified, house owners deal with a decision in between trying DIY repair work and engaging expert services. The suitable option depends upon the intensity of the damage, the homeowner's ability level, and the type of window included.
For minor concerns such as seals that have started to pull away from little areas of the frame, silicone-based sealants developed forwindow repair may provide a short-term option. This method requires cautious cleaning of the affected location, precise application of the sealant, and adequate treating time before the window is exposed to stress or moisture. Nevertheless, DIY repair work to failed window seals usually address only surface signs instead of the underlying failure, and may not restore the window's original energy effectiveness.
Specialist window seal repair often includes more detailed methods. For sealed unit failures where the insulating gas has left, some professionals provide services to drill little holes in the glass, dry the interior cavity, and reintroduce insulating gas before sealing the holes. While this process can improve clarity and some insulating residential or commercial properties, it normally can not bring back the window to its initial specs.
The most reliable long-lasting service for failed window seals generally involves replacing the affected insulated glass system (IGU) completely. This method eliminates the unsuccessful seal system entirely and installs a new system with fresh seals and, if desired, upgraded glass compositions for improved performance. While this represents a greater preliminary financial investment, it provides the most reliable and lasting outcomes.
| Repair Approach | Typical Cost Range | Duration | Efficiency |
|---|---|---|---|
| DIY Sealant Application | ₤ 15 - ₤ 50 | 1-2 hours | Momentary (6-12 months) |
| Professional IGU Refill | ₤ 100 - ₤ 300 | 2-4 hours | Moderate (2-5 years) |
| IGU Replacement | ₤ 200 - ₤ 700+ | 1-3 days | Long-term (15-20+ years) |
Maintaining Window Seals for Longevity
Preventive upkeep significantly extends the life of window seals and assists property owners avoid expensive repair work. Routine assessment of window seals, ideally performed two times yearly during seasonal shifts, permits property owners to determine and resolve minor deterioration before it advances to complete failure.
Cleaning window seals needs gentle handling and suitable products. Property owners should use soft cloths or sponges with moderate, non-abrasive cleaners, avoiding harsh chemicals that can break down seal products. Particular attention needs to be paid to the edges where seals fulfill the frame and glass, as dirt accumulation in these locations can accelerate degeneration.
Proper ventilation throughout the home assists manage humidity levels that can stress window seals. Utilizing exhaust fans in restrooms and cooking areas, guaranteeing sufficient attic ventilation, and maintaining constant indoor humidity levels between 30% and 50% lowers the wetness concern on window seals and minimizes condensation concerns.
Frequently Asked Questions
How long do window seals typically last?
The life expectancy of window seals varies significantly based on ecological conditions, installation quality, and the products utilized. Top quality windows with premium seals may maintain integrity for 15 to 20 years or longer, while seals in severe climates or lower-quality windows might stop working within 5 to 10 years. Routine upkeep can maximize seal durability.
Does window seal failure need immediate repair?
While stopped working window seals do not usually cause instant structural damage, delaying repair can cause progressively worse problems. As seals deteriorate even more, the danger of water seepage increases, possibly causing damage to window frames, walls, and insulation. Additionally, continued energy loss collects expenses gradually, making prompt repair financially sensible.
Can I repair simply the seal, or do I require to replace the entire window?
For the most part, the sealed unit containing the glass panes must be replaced rather than repaired. The seal is essential to the insulated glass building and can not be accessed without jeopardizing the system. However, changing only the insulated glass system while keeping the original window frame often provides a cost-efficient option that costs significantly less than full window replacement.
Will repaired windows look as good as new?
When professional repair or replacement is carried out properly, the visual results typically match new window setups. Condensation problems deal with totally, and the glass surfaces can be cleaned up to restore clarity. Windows that have actually developed mineral deposits from long-term wetness direct exposure might need time for these marks to fade as the glass dries totally.
Are some windows more susceptible to seal failure than others?
Windows manufactured with inferior materials or low quality installation practices tend to experience earlier seal failure. Additionally, windows exposed to direct sunlight, extreme temperatures, or coastal environments with salt direct exposure face increased tension on seals. Investing in quality windows with detailed guarantees supplies greater long-lasting reliability.
